Abstract

Informal settlements are often temporary settlements which exist without the usual residential infrastructure, including no electricity. This paper presents a case study for a particular informal settlement in terms of 3 possibilities of a styles of electrification, consisting of grid connection, photovoltaic systems for large household solar and small household solar systems. The effect of no land tenure is shown to be an overriding factor.
